Transaction d255ec7e7b37c733bd75f718e81f66c0579b103acc7b8cfafb363a1bf7429526

block
cc06561cfdabb7f7e49ceebffc2e6467a47fd223ed1865ea303d2efc59a2b342

1 Input

570 Outputs